What are Physical Barriers?
Physical barriers are tangible obstacles designed to prevent unauthorized access to facilities. Their main function is to deter, delay, or detect potential intruders. Examples include walls, fences, gates, turnstiles, or even natural barriers such as bodies of water.

Why are they Important?
Physical barriers are vital to prevent unauthorized access, protect valuable resources, and ensure safety. They deter potential intruders or delay their progress, providing additional time for the security response.

How do Physical Barriers Work?
Physical Barriers work by creating a physical blockade that is difficult to bypass. They should be coupled with security controls such as surveillance systems, intruder alarms, or security personnel for maximum effectiveness.

Exam Tips: Answering Questions on Physical Barriers

  1. Understand the function and importance of different types of physical barriers and how they complement other security measures.
  2. Remember that the effectiveness of a physical barrier depends on its design, placement, and integration with other security layers.
  3. When presented with a scenario, consider the most suitable type of physical barrier and explain why it would be effective.
  4. Be ready to discuss the limitations of physical barriers and additional security measures that can address those weaknesses.

Physical Barriers are essential components of physical security that act as a primary line of defense against unauthorized access or intrusion. These barriers can be natural or man-made structures that deter, delay, and detect unauthorized intruders. Some examples of physical barriers include fences, walls, doors, windows, security gates, and turnstiles. The effectiveness of the physical barrier depends on its design, materials, height, and the level of difficulty to bypass it in terms of time and effort. Strategic implementation of these barriers is crucial in directing the flow of visitor traffic and providing multiple layers of security.
